Children’s Mental Health Week
As part of Children’s Mental Health Week, we were delighted to welcome Katie to lead a series of wellbeing workshops throughout the school. The sessions focused on the powerful connection between body and brain, teaching the children how to "make their minds happy through movement." The pupils thoroughly enjoyed the experience, leaving the workshops feeling energized, positive, and happy.

Well Fest at Southborough School .
A group of Year 4's enjoyed their day at Southborough High School for their annual wellbeing festival. They were able to enjoy activities like figurine painting, playing with fidgets, doing fitness challenges, having their nails painted and much more.
